Lecturer in Philosophy (Continuing - 2 positions)

$124,638 - $141,317 a year

Permanent

2d ago , from Australian National University

Classification/Academic Level: Academic Level B (Lecturer)
Salary package: $124,638 - $ 141,317 per annum plus 17% superannuation.
Terms: 2 X Full-time, Continuing
Commencement: Flexible with a preference for the first half of 2027.

Areas of Specialisation:

- Position 1: Ethics and/or social and political philosophy.
- Position 2: Open with Philosophy and AI as an area of competence.

The Position: The School is looking to appoint two outstanding scholars whose expertise will complement the School’s existing strengths. Both appointees will be expected to carry out world-leading research resulting in regular publications in leading venues, contribute to the School’s stellar teaching program, supervise HDR students, apply for external grants, and be available for service roles as appropriate. At least one of the appointees will work in ethics and/or social and political philosophy. The other will work in any area that complements the School’s existing strengths, including the capacity to contribute to teaching in Philosophy and AI.

The School The School of Philosophy, Research School of Social Sciences, is a world-leading department that combines several of the world's most cited living philosophers with energetic and award-winning mid-career and early career researchers. ANU philosophers enjoy what is widely recognized as one of the world’s best environments for research and teaching in Philosophy. Our principal strengths are in moral and political philosophy, philosophyof science (especially philosophy of biology, probability, and decision theory), and philosophyof mind and psychology. We have a proud reputationof repeatedly winning significant support for both individual- and team-projects fromthe Australian Research Council,



and every year welcome many international visitors to Canberra, hosting multiple workshops each year, as well as a vibrant series of weekly research seminars and reading groups. We have a constant flow of postdoctoral researchers, who go on to continuing positions at leading departments worldwide. We have three major research Centres— the Centre for Moral, Social and Political Theory, the Centre for Philosophyof the Sciences, and the Centre for Consciousness.

The College The ANU College of Arts and Social Sciences (CASS) is the largest of the six Colleges at ANU. It is structured into two main research schools,offers degrees in more than 20 discipline areas and excels in research across the humanities and social sciences. The College has a substantial international research presence and is a major source of national policy advice. Our academic staff are internationally recognised for their research, and many are members of the Australian Academy of the Humanities, the Academy of the Social Sciences of Australia, or both. A hub of vibrant activity, we host numerous lectures, concerts and exhibitions each year, most of which are open to the public. Our students, staff and graduates come from more than 60 nations, bringing a diversity of perspective to campus life.
